Directions: Find out the correct meaning of the idiom/phrase from the four alternatives.

To give ear to

  1. To exult in triumph

  2. A deceitful person

  3. To act stupidly

  4. To pay attention

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

To give ear to means to listen carefully or to pay attention to what someone is saying.
